An ordinance to establish requirements for the
proper handling of leaves in the Township of Nutley, so as to protect
public health, safety and welfare, and to prescribe penalties for
the failure to comply.

LEAF DISPOSAL
The placement of leaves in biodegradable paper bags with
a maximum weight of 50 pounds which can be composted together with
leaves, such as to prevent the yard waste from spilling or blowing
out into the street and coming into contact with stormwater.
LEAVES
Leaves generated from residential or commercial premises
located within the Township of Nutley which have been source separated
from solid waste, including but not limited to sticks, branches, grass
clippings, foreign material and construction material.
PERSON
Any individual, corporation, company, partnership, firm,
association, or political subdivision of this state subject to municipal
jurisdiction.
STREET
Any street, avenue, boulevard, road, parkway, viaduct, drive,
or other way which is an existing state, county, or municipal roadway,
and includes the land between the street lines, whether improved or
unimproved, and may comprise pavement, shoulders, gutters, curbs,
sidewalks, parking areas, and other areas within the street lines.
Leaf disposal shall take place at the curb of
any public roadway for collection by the Township of Nutley from October
15 through December 15 of each calendar year.
The owner or occupant of any property, or any
employee or contractor of such owner or occupant engaged to provide
lawn care or landscaping services, shall not sweep, rake, blow, or
otherwise place leaves, unless the leaves are placed in biodegradable
bags as required herein, in the street. If leaves that are not containerized
are placed in the street, the party responsible for the placement
of the leaves must remove the leaves from the street or said party
shall be deemed in violation of this article.
The provisions of this article shall be enforced
by an authorized representative of the Department of Public Works
of the Township of Nutley or a member of the Township of Nutley Police
Department.
Any person who is found to be in violation of
the provisions of this article shall be subject to a fine not to exceed
$500.
